Techland has revealed a new infographic to show off the statistics from the recently held Dying Light event called Buggy Frenzy. Developers had asked players to run over 5 million zombies during the specified time period. Players, however, exceeded expectations by taking out 18.1M and as a result earned a pair of new Buggy skins.

After months of anticipation, Techland has announced that Dying Light: The Following Enhanced Edition is now on sale. The updated edition brings Nightmare Mode, 250 Legend levels, a new Bounty system as well as The Following expansion, all previously released DLC, community-made maps alongside technical improvements.

Behold the most challenging and cruel face of Dying Light: The Following Enhanced Edition. In this new difficulty level called Nightmare Mode, we introduce XP penalties for dying, ramp up enemy strength, restrict overpowered Easter Egg weapons, and much more. The Nightmare Mode is part of the Enhanced Edition, which launches February 9th 2016. About the game: Dying Light is an action survival horror game presented in first-person perspective.
